New Age Training is a private institution in New York, New York with 157 undergraduate students. For nursing students, the useful read is not just whether a program exists, but how its tuition, completion rates, debt, and earnings compare with nearby options.

In-state tuition is N/A compared with a New York nursing-school average of $22,130. The school reports a graduation rate of 74.4%, median earnings of $31,997, and median federal debt of $7,789.

Affordability Context

76.6% of students receive Pell Grants, a useful signal for how often the school serves lower-income students. 75.3% of students take federal loans, so borrowing is common in the student body. The three-year loan default rate is 0.0%, which helps frame repayment risk alongside earnings and debt.

Student Demographics

The student body is largest among Black students (52.2%), followed by Hispanic students (38.9%) and White students (3.8%).
